A timeline records an order: invitations preceded new members, then conversations and useful answers appeared. This chronology alone cannot tell you what caused the community to grow.

Notice: before does not mean because.

Timeline ≠ sequence

A timeline places events in time. A sequence gives stages an order. Equal spacing in a sequence does not imply equal duration.

Sequence ≠ causation

“B follows A” is different from “A produces B.” A causal arrow adds a claim that needs evidence beyond the drawing.

Feedback ≠ reinforcement

A loop can amplify change or counteract it. Signs, delays, and external conditions determine its behavior.

A diagram is a choice
about what counts.

A useful picture helps you notice a relationship. A dangerous picture makes you forget that other relationships exist.

Start with the question you need to answer. Draw the simplest structure that helps. Then change the structure and ask what your first picture made invisible.

The twelve-part taxonomy is a thinking aid, not a validated or exhaustive scientific classification. “Hides” means that a relationship is easy to overlook in a simple version of the diagram; a richer diagram can often make it visible.

  1. Larkin & Simon (1987), Why a Diagram Is (Sometimes) Worth Ten Thousand Words. Two representations can hold equivalent information while making different inferences easier to find. This is supporting research for the general principle, not the source of the twelve categories.
  2. Kirsh & Maglio (1994), On Distinguishing Epistemic from Pragmatic Action. Their Tetris research describes actions that change the world to make a problem easier to think through. Rearranging a diagram applies that broader idea here; it was not the experiment they tested.

The poster calls the support supplied by external structures “co-cognition,” and the risk of mistaking a representation for reality “cognitive drift.” Those labels are retained as the poster’s framing, rather than attributed to the papers above.
